• pvr.ccz 与 png 格式 互转的解决方案


    pvr.ccz与png互转

    pvr是苹果的一种图片格式,我们需要转成png,最简单的办法就是用TexturePacker.

    准备工作

    步骤/方法

    1、新建一个 bat文件 如:PVR转PNG.bat

    PVR转PNG.bat脚本

    2、输入内容如下:

    rem 请核对你的texturepacker安装路径
    
    @echo off
      
    path %path%;"C:Program Files (x86)CodeAndWebTexturePackerin"
      
    for /f "usebackq tokens=*" %%d in (`dir /s /b *.pvr *.pvr.ccz *.pvr.gz`) do (
        TexturePacker.exe "%%d" --sheet "%%~dpnd.png" --data "%%~dpnd.plist" --opt RGBA8888 --allow-free-size --algorithm Basic --no-trim --dither-fs
    )
      
    pause
     

    注意事项

    注:第3行中的 %path%;后的路径为自己本机的TexturePacker路径,例如我的安装路径

    imageimage

    可以将第6行的 %%~dpnd.png 改成 %%~dpnd.jpg,就可以转成jpg

    3、把这个bat文件和需要转换的*.ccz文件放在同一目录下

    4、然后双击bat,会弹出一个CMD窗口,不要关闭它等待它完成

    5、转换好之后的 png 会放在同一目录下

    PNG转PVR.bat脚本

    rem 请核对你的texturepacker安装路径
    @echo off
     
    path %path%;"C:Program Files (x86)CodeAndWebTexturePackerin"
     
    for /f "usebackq tokens=*" %%d in (`dir /s /b *.png`) do (
    TexturePacker.exe "%%d" --sheet "%%~dpnd.pvr" --data "%%~dpnd.plist" --opt PVRTC4 --allow-free-size --algorithm Basic --no-trim --dither-fs
    )
     
    pause

    文档资料

    文中内容参考以下博客,经实践可行,感谢博主分享。

    http://www.cppblog.com/tx7do/archive/2014/06/03/207180.aspx

    http://blog.csdn.net/dahuichen/article/details/30071583

  • 相关阅读:
    软件工程——理论、方法与实践 第三章
    软件工程——理论、方法与实践 第二章
    软件工程——理论、方法与实践 第一章
    使用@RunWith(SpringJUnit4ClassRunner.class)进行单元测试时 报错 和 java.lang.NoSuchMethodError的解决方法
    springMVC 校验时,CustomValidationMessages.properties中的错误提示信息的中文乱码 问题
    通过scrapy,从模拟登录开始爬取知乎的问答数据
    利用AJAX JAVA 通过Echarts实现豆瓣电影TOP250的数据可视化
    Scrapy爬取伯乐在线的所有文章
    搭建第一个scrapy项目的常见问题
    利用Ajax实现数据的同步传输,从mysql中提取数据,通过echarts可视化
  • 原文地址:https://www.cnblogs.com/zhaoqingqing/p/3921833.html
Copyright © 2020-2023  润新知